I almost forgot that Mill Road Feast kicked off a year ago.  For those who haven’t been, Mill Road Feast is a quarterly pop up market offering local produce and street food held around the vibey Mill Road area. It all started on Gwydir Street car park but will be held this time at Donkey’s green (opposite Parkers Piece at the start of Mill Road). A perfect spot, which will probably attract even more visitors.

There is more to celebrate on the 1st of March, a new street food trader! After Jack Gelato pushing a bike with his Gelato, we will now have Will of Scrumptious soups doing the same, but instead of Gelato, he will be selling steaming cups of soups.

Scrumptious soups

Scrumptious soups will be selling daily made, fresh, organic soups, of the highest quality from their custom-made soup bike designed by Will himself. You can get a glimpse of the building process on his Facebook page. The design is based on a Pashley ice cream bike. Will worked together on the clever design with the team of Providence, who built the platform in which he can store large thermos. This then forms a serving platform, as well as a storing platform.

Will has a good background, having worked at Cotto. It’s almost needless to say, that this was a huge inspiration for him. One of his ‘secret ingredients’ is, the helping hand of the Master chef fine-tuning the scrumptious soups. Coupled with bread from Bread on Bike’s delicious Czech bread with pumpkin seeds,  this heartwarming, finger tingling soup will soon be the talk of the town!
